Starting from
August 1, 2025
, authorities have enacted a temporary ban on gasoline exports by all producers. Previously, from March, partial export restrictions for independent traders were in place, but the ban has now been extended to cover the entire market to direct maximum volumes of gasoline towards domestic needs. The embargo is officially imposed until August 31 inclusively, but authorities do not rule out extending the restriction into September if necessary.

MOSCOW, September 2 - RIA Novosti. Reducing oil producers' costs, including lowering Russian Railways' tariff rates, could lead to the stabilization of fuel prices, Sergey Tereshkin, CEO of the petroleum products marketplace Open Oil Market (a Skolkovo resident), told RIA Novosti.
The rise in retail fuel prices continues to slow down. According to Rosstat data, from August 20 to 26, gasoline prices rose by 0.2%, while diesel prices increased by 0.1%.
